Neville Johnson 032 | 2RRF, British Army

Neville Johnson served with the 2nd Battalion, The Royal Regiment of Fusiliers, British Army. Born and raised in South Africa, he joined the British Army in the early 2000s deploying multiple times throughout his service, to include Northern Ireland, Iraq and Afghanistan. He is a published poet and his piece on Sangin is featured in the episode intro.
